To address chemical safety effectively, we must first understand the risks associated with chemical exposure. A comprehensive risk assessment should be the foundation upon which safety measures are built. This assessment involves identifying potential hazards, understanding exposure routes, and evaluating the possible health effects. By employing a combination of quantitative and qualitative evaluations, companies and organizations can make informed decisions about the chemicals they use and their potential impacts on health and the environment.

Moreover, education plays a crucial role in chemical safety. Training programs that equip employees and stakeholders with the knowledge to handle chemicals responsibly can significantly reduce the incidence of accidents. Key components of these programs should include proper labeling, safe storage practices, and emergency response protocols. Consistent and ongoing education establishes a culture of safety, empowering individuals to prioritize safety and communicate concerns with confidence.

Another vital edge in the quest for chemical safety is the adoption of technology. Advancements in monitoring technologies allow for real-time tracking of chemical exposure levels in various environments, from factories to homes. Wearable devices that measure exposure to hazardous substances can empower workers to take preventative measures or report unsafe conditions immediately. Additionally, artificial intelligence can enhance risk assessment processes by analyzing vast amounts of data quickly, identifying patterns, and predicting potential hazards before they escalate.
